Games - Recommendation Recommendations for Games like „REPLACED“?

7 Upvotes

This Game has absolutely flashed me. I was never a Fan of Sidescroller or Pixel Art but this Game told me a lesson. Wow! 😊

Can you recommend Games like REPLACED or is it „one of a kind“? Also tried searching via Google but did not find Stuff which pulled my interest.

What I enjoyed in REPLACED:
+ Dark / Dystopian Atmosphere
+ Soundtrack and Sound Design in General
+ Simple but Impactful Combat
+ Mini Puzzles (like Hacking)
+ Climbing and Jumping Puzzles
+ 2,5D Design (not only 1 Plain/Level on Screen)
+ Camera Work („Dynamic Angles)

Games - General Game Pass on a TV is making me question how much I actually need an Xbox console

167 Upvotes

I've been using Xbox cloud gaming directly on my Hisense TV lately, and the weirdest part is how quickly it starts to feel normal.

Turn on the TV, open the Xbox app, connect a controller and you're basically in. No console sitting under the TV, no installs, no storage management.

Obviously I'm not saying cloud gaming replaces a Series X for everyone. If I cared about the best image quality or played competitively, I'd still want local hardware.

But for someone who mostly jumps between Game Pass games casually from the couch… I'm starting to wonder what would actually push me to buy the console now.
